* fix(security): require authentication for image file endpoint (H-2)

- Changed /api/v1/files/image from AuthType.NONE to USER_TOKEN_OR_API_KEY
- Added Permission.RESOURCE_VIEW requirement
- Prevents unauthenticated cross-tenant file access via leaked keys
- Fixes HIGH severity finding from multi-tenant security review

* test: add comprehensive cross-tenant isolation tests

Added 7 critical test scenarios for multi-tenant boundaries:
- Cross-tenant bot access prevention
- Viewer role read-only enforcement
- Removed member immediate access revocation
- Model provider credential isolation
- WebSocket message isolation
- Invitation token workspace scoping
- Multi-workspace context validation

These tests address P0-2 coverage gaps for:
- workspaces.py (membership & invitation flows)
- user.py (authentication & authorization)
- websocket_chat.py (real-time isolation)
- plugins.py (resource access control)

* fix(security): resolve M-1, M-2, M-3 security findings

M-1: WebSocket authorization TOCTOU race (FIXED)
- Changed _revalidate_websocket_authorization to return RequestContext
- Ensures validated context is used immediately without race window
- Prevents removed members from sending messages during revalidation gap

M-2: Model Manager cache workspace isolation (VERIFIED)
- Confirmed _CacheKey already uses 4-tuple: (instance, workspace, generation, resource)
- Cache is properly scoped per workspace, no cross-tenant leakage possible
- No code change needed, documented as working correctly

M-3: Invitation lock workspace scoping (FIXED)
- Changed lock key from token_digest to workspace_uuid:token_digest
- Prevents DoS where attacker locks token in Workspace A to block Workspace B
- Locks now isolated per workspace

All MEDIUM severity findings from security review now resolved.
